Quinoa and CKD: Potassium Data per 100 g
For Potassium, Quinoa provides 172 mg per 100 g, or 9% of the daily limit. Compared with the daily potassium allowance, this is a Low level.
About Quinoa
Quinoa sits in the Grains & Starches group. Grains and starches are usually relatively low in potassium and phosphorus, making them a sensible base for a CKD diet. Watch whole-grain and some processed grain products, which can carry more phosphorus.
